Nicole 'Snooki' Polizzi says doctors found 'cancerous cells' in her cervix
Share and Follow


Nicole “Snooki” Polizzi is urging her followers to prioritize their health and undergo cervical cancer screenings after a concerning medical discovery. The reality TV star, famous for her role on “Jersey Shore,” revealed that doctors identified “cancerous cells” on her cervix, prompting further medical evaluations.

In a TikTok video shared on January 20, Polizzi, who is 38 years old, opened up about her health journey. She shared that for the past few years, her routine Pap smear tests have returned abnormal results, indicating the presence of precancerous cells. This revelation led her to undergo additional, more detailed examinations.

Polizzi described undergoing several more intensive procedures, including a biopsy and a colposcopy, which she admitted were “uncomfortable.” After these tests, her doctor informed her that cancerous cells were indeed present at the top of her cervix.

Reflecting on the moment she received the call from her doctor, Polizzi recounted, “The doctor calls me and he’s like, ‘Not looking great.'” Her candid account in the nearly 10-minute video serves as a powerful reminder of the importance of regular health screenings.

The mother of three urged her followers to get their screenings and not to skip out on tests. 

“I’m terrified. It’s scary,” she said. “We have to get it done because cervical cancer is nothing to joke about and I obviously don’t want to get this.”

“Being a woman is not easy and this is definitely a scary thing,” she said. “I know I’m gonna be fine, but it’s just scary to have to do all this stuff.” 

Polizzi started to tear up when explaining the possibilities of treatment, which include having a hysterectomy, or a surgery to remove the uterus, depending on the next test results. 

“I’m done having kids but, as a woman, the thought of getting a hysterectomy is just sad and it’s scary,” she said. “Getting the hysterectomy and then not being able to have kids, I think that’s what’s killing me.”

She said if it comes to it, she would get the surgery done to keep her “healthy and safe to be here for my kids that I have now.” 

She encouraged women going through similar health scares to share their stories in the comments to find a community that can support each other.
